Lake Wöhrder in Nuremberg

Many years ago, the artificial Lake Wöhrder was created for one reason in particular: to protect Nuremberg Old Town from flood water. But in the meantime, this reservoir in the middle of the city has become a local recreation area for the people of Nuremberg. You can swim, hire pedal boats and stand-up paddling boards or just laze away the hours.
